No-bake Cookie Dough Bars
Serves 9
No-Bake Cookie Dough Bars are a rich treat that will heavily satisfy any sweet tooth. A simple cookie dough filling is topped with a chocolate and peanut butter mixture that will make you want to sing.

Cookie Dough Filling
  1. 1/2 cup butter
  2. 3/4 cup brown sugar
  3. 1/2 teaspoon vanilla
  4. 2 cups flour
  5. 14 oz sweetened condensed milk
  6. 2 cups milk chocolate chips
Topping
  1. 1 cup peanut butter
  2. 3/4 cup milk chocolate chips
Instructions
  1. 1. Grease a 9x9 inch pan. To prepare the cookie dough filling, cream the butter and brown sugar until light and fluffy. Add vanilla and mix. Alternately add the flour and sweetened condensed milk. Fold in the chocolate chips.
  2. 2. For the topping, micowave the peanut butter and chocolate chips in increments of 30 seconds at a power level of 60 percent, until melted. Stir in between each thirty second increment. Spread the topping on top of the bars. Chill bars for about one hour or until the topping is firm. You can pop them in the freezer to chill more quickly. These bars keep best covered and refrigerated. Enjoy!
